Selecting high-quality quartz slabs is crucial for achieving the desired elegance and functionality in your spaces. Here are four essential tips to guide you through the selection process.

**

1. Assess the Composition

**

Before making a purchase, it's important to understand what quartz slabs are made of. High-quality quartz is often composed of about 90-95% natural quartz crystals combined with resins, polymers, and pigments. When selecting slabs, look out for:

  • Durability: Ensure that the slabs are engineered to withstand wear and tear.
  • Uniformity: Check for consistent coloration and patterning across the slab, which signifies quality craftsmanship.
  • Certificates: Seek products that come with certifications, ensuring they meet industry standards for quality.
**

2. Examine the Finish

**

The finish of a quartz slab significantly influences its aesthetic appeal and functionality. When evaluating finishes, consider the following aspects:

  • Polished vs. Honed: Polished finishes offer a shiny and reflective surface, while honed finishes provide a matte look; choose based on your style preference and usage.
  • Sealing: Ensure that the surface is properly sealed to prevent staining and enhance durability.
  • Texture: Different textures can affect maintenance; consider how easy it will be to clean and care for various finishes.
**

3. Check for Warranty and Brand Reputation

**

The brand you choose can have a profound impact on the quality of your quartz slabs. Always investigate the following:

  • Warranty: A good warranty signifies manufacturer confidence in their product. Look for slabs with extended warranties, commonly ranging from 10 to 25 years.
  • Brand Reputation: Research brands that are well-known in the industry. Customer feedback and reviews can provide insight into reliability and service quality.
  • Product Range: Established brands typically offer a wider array of colors and patterns, providing you with more design options.
**

4. Visit Showrooms and Ask Questions

**

Lastly, before finalizing your choice, consider visiting physical showrooms. Here are some benefits of this approach:

  • Visual Assessment: Seeing quartz slabs in person allows you to assess texture, color, and patterns more accurately than online photos.
  • Sample Cuts: Requesting small samples can help you visualize how the slab will look in your chosen spaces.
  • Expert Guidance: Engage with knowledgeable sales staff to answer any specific questions you may have about installation, care, and product specifications.
